1991 Mercury 90HP
Tack will not work things checked so far

Have power to tach
have good ground
took out tach put in friends boat works perfect
put his tach in my boat does not work.
Have continuity from grey wire from motor to back of tach
Battery is charging great so I am guessing rectifier is good
boat runs and idles perfect
I see the grey wire goes into a square moduale Dont know how to test that piece whatever it is.
Any suggestions?

Test your rectifier even tho it appears to be charging.

If you use an analog meter set it on the RX1000 scale.
If using a digital meter, set it on the diode symbol.

1. Disconnect the battery leads.
2. Disconnect all wires on the rectifier.
3. Connect the red test lead to ground and the black lead alternately to terminals A and C.
The meter should show continuity.
4. Connect the black lead to gound and the red lead alternately to terminals A and C.
The meter should not show continuity.
5. Connect the black lead to terminal B and the red lead alternately to terminals A and C.
The meter should show continuity.
6. Connect the red lead to terminal B and the black lead alternately to terminals A and C.
The meter should not show continuity.
7. Replace the rectifier if you do not get correct readings.

Ended up replacing the rectifier and it now works perfect.
